Output d073039ca701e2a6a16ec4bec1e61faf6e3efb488dce2becaa1fe9a1030c29b3:1

value
5889427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c293bea5b7213742500245c1be192880ee1fa161 OP_EQUAL
address
MRdzK8PHaacm5CZbVVfvhbQDgk8uq74dmS
transaction
d073039ca701e2a6a16ec4bec1e61faf6e3efb488dce2becaa1fe9a1030c29b3
spent
true